    Who is Dr. Lloyd, Ophthalmologist in Palo Alto, CA?

    Dr. Mary Ann Lloyd, MD is an Ophthalmologist, who primarily practices in Palo Alto, CA with 2 additional practice locations. She is board certified by the American Board of Ophthalmology. Dr. Lloyd completed her residency at Med Coll Wi Affil Hosps, Ophthalmology; Mount Zion M C Univ Ca, Internal Medicine. Dr. Lloyd is fluent in English,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Lloyd’s practice accepts Cigna, Medicaid,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Mary Ann Lloyd's specialty?

    Dr. Lloyd is a Ophthalmologist near Palo Alto, CA. An ophthalmologist possesses the knowledge and professional skills required to deliver comprehensive eye and vision care. These medical doctors are trained to diagnose, monitor, and treat all ocular and visual disorders, whether through medical or surgical interventions. Their expertise encompasses a wide range of issues affecting the eye and its structures, including the eyelids, orbit, and visual pathways.
